Dark Horse announces ‘Criminal Macabre: The Complete Cal McDonald Stories’

The world has two faces. The natural and the supernatural. The face we see every day, people filing past us in an almost zombie…

Dark Horse has announced a new edition to Steve Niles’ Criminal Macabre: The Complete Cal McDonald Stories which will feature two new tales and an introduction by horror legend John Carpenter. The collection collects the complete Criminal Macabre prose stories Savage MembraneGuns, Drugs, and MonstersDial M for MonsterAll My Bloody Things, and the two new stories The Dead Son and Out of Water. You can find it in comic book shops and book stores on March 2, 2022.

So what’s it about?

The world has two faces. The natural and the supernatural. The face we see every day, people filing past us in an almost zombie-like stupor, numb to the horrors of everyday life or driven to madness by the pain and agony of modern-day existence. And those are the people who aren’t zombies or monsters!

Cal McDonald is a detective with one foot in the real world, and one in the world of magic. For Cal, the horrors we all dream about in the fevered darkness of the night are all-too real, kept at bay through an almost constant influx of drugs to numb the pain, but never erase it. Cut from the same mold as Sam Spade, Jake Gittes, and the famous detectives of Chandler, Hammett and Spillane, Cal McDonald, whether he likes it or not, is all that stands between us and the nightmare world just outside our vision.
